Post-Update: Steps for Accurate Calibration
After a software update on your Mercedes head-up display, accurate calibration becomes essential to ensure optimal performance and an immersive driving experience. The process involves several steps designed to fine-tune the system’s accuracy, mirroring the vehicle’s real-world dynamics. Begin by parking the car in a well-lit area, away from direct sunlight, to prevent glare that could affect calibration. Next, activate the head-up display and navigate to the calibration menu, usually found under the settings or system maintenance options.
Follow the on-screen instructions, which may include positioning specific objects, like road signs or lane markings, within the display’s view. This enables the system to adjust its projection accordingly. Remember, precision is key; ensure the display accurately reflects the surroundings without any significant deviations. Resolving Common Issues in Head-Up Display Calibration
Many drivers experience issues with their Mercedes head-up display (HUD) after software updates, leading to an inaccurate or distorted view of vital driving information. To resolve common problems, start by ensuring proper calibration. This can be achieved through the vehicle’s settings menu, often featuring dedicated HUD calibration options. If adjustments don’t correct the issue, consider a systematic approach: check for loose connections within the HUD assembly and inspect for any physical damage, such as cracks or debris. A detailed user manual or consultation with a Mercedes-certified technician can guide you through these checks.
For more complex problems persisting after initial calibration attempts, visit a reputable collision repair shop. Skilled technicians there have access to specialized tools and diagnostic software that can pinpoint and rectify issues, whether it’s an electrical malfunction, sensor glitch, or misaligned projection.
